Creating the perfect zucchini noodles is the first step in this delightful dish. To begin, you will need a spiralizer, which is an essential tool for transforming whole zucchinis into noodles. There are various types of spiralizers available, from handheld models to countertop versions. Regardless of the type you choose, the process is straightforward. Simply wash the zucchinis, trim the ends, and secure them in the spiralizer to create long, thin strands.
Once you have your zucchini noodles, it’s crucial to address moisture, as zucchini tends to retain water. To prevent a watery dish, lightly salt the noodles and let them sit for about 10-15 minutes. This process helps to draw out excess moisture, ensuring that your Caprese remains fresh and vibrant.
While the zucchini noodles are resting, you can prepare the other ingredients for your Zesty Zucchini Noodle Caprese. Start with the cherry tomatoes; wash them thoroughly and slice them in half. This not only makes them easier to eat but also allows their natural juices to mingle with the rest of the ingredients.
Next, it’s time to handle the fresh mozzarella. Drain the bocconcini from their brine, and if they are larger than bite-sized, you can cut them in half or quarters for easy incorporation into the dish. The creamy mozzarella will provide a delightful contrast to the fresh vegetables and herbs.

When preparing your Zesty Zucchini Noodle Caprese, one crucial step that can elevate your dish is the method of incorporating basil. Tearing basil leaves instead of chopping them helps to preserve their essential oils and natural flavors. The act of tearing not only releases more aromatic compounds, which can significantly enhance the overall taste of your salad, but it also contributes to a more rustic presentation. As the leaves break apart, they create a beautiful texture that contrasts nicely with the smoothness of the mozzarella and the crunchiness of the zucchini noodles.
Now that your basil is prepared, it’s time to combine all the ingredients into a delightful medley. Start by placing your zucchini noodles in a large mixing bowl. Gently add the halved cherry tomatoes and torn basil leaves to the bowl, ensuring that everything is evenly distributed. It’s crucial to handle the ingredients with care, especially when incorporating the mozzarella balls.
To avoid mashing the mozzarella, use a light hand when mixing. Rather than vigorously tossing the ingredients, consider folding them together. This technique allows the mozzarella to maintain its shape while ensuring that each component is well-coated with the flavors of the basil and tomatoes. Aim for a light and airy combination that retains the individual textures of each ingredient.

With your ingredients beautifully combined, it’s time to dress the salad. The dressing for your Zesty Zucchini Noodle Caprese is a simple yet impactful blend of olive oil and balsamic glaze.
A common guideline for dressing salads is to use a ratio of three parts oil to one part vinegar or glaze. For this dish, start with two tablespoons of good-quality extra virgin olive oil and one tablespoon of balsamic glaze. Drizzle the olive oil over the salad first, followed by the balsamic glaze. This order helps to ensure even distribution of flavors. Gently toss the salad again to coat everything evenly.
Don’t forget to season your salad with salt and freshly cracked black pepper. This is a vital step that enhances the natural flavors of the ingredients. The salt will help to draw out moisture from the tomatoes and zucchini, intensifying their flavors while the pepper adds a touch of warmth. A squeeze of fresh lemon juice can also be a delightful addition, brightening the dish even further.

One of the many reasons to love Zesty Zucchini Noodle Caprese is its versatility. This dish can easily adapt to various dietary preferences and occasions.
For those looking to add more heartiness to the dish, consider incorporating protein. Grilled chicken or shrimp can be a fantastic addition, transforming your salad into a satisfying main course. Simply grill your protein of choice, slice it, and layer it atop the salad before serving.
Vegetarians can also have fun with this dish. You might include other vegetables such as bell peppers, asparagus, or even roasted eggplant for added flavor and nutrition. Alternatively, tossing in some chickpeas or lentils can introduce an interesting texture and additional protein to the mix.
For vegan options, simply replace the fresh mozzarella with a dairy-free cheese alternative. There are many flavorful vegan cheeses available on the market today, or you can make your own by blending soaked cashews with nutritional yeast, lemon juice, and a touch of garlic powder for a creamy, tangy spread. This ensures that everyone can enjoy the fresh flavors of your Zesty Zucchini Noodle Caprese.
